Havent had any malfunctions. I take it to the range a lot to keep the round counts down on the others. I can practice “no tool” detail strips on it with minimal guilt.
The only wart is the magazine release is difficult to press because of spring tension, and the catch protrudes much farther into the mag well than my other 1911s. I’m going to replace it with a GI so I can insert non-Brixia magazines without having to press the mag release. The Brixia mag has a taper near the top that gets it past the larger catch.
It’s reliable and fun to shoot, and you can’t beat $380.
